Navigating the Road: Core Mechanics and Gameplay Strategies
The foundation of this game rests upon the principle of skillful avoidance. As your character automatically progresses along the road, a variety of obstacles appear with increasing frequency and complexity. These can range from stationary barriers to moving hazards, demanding quick reflexes and predictive thinking. Successfully navigating these challenges is crucial for survival and maintaining a high score. One common strategy involves anticipating obstacle patterns; observing the timing and placement of hazards allows players to prepare for incoming threats, improving their reaction time. Learning to prioritize collecting rabbits versus avoiding obstacles is also key – sometimes, a slight diversion to secure a rabbit isn’t worth the risk of an imminent collision.

Enhancements and Power-Ups: Boosting Your Gameplay
Many iterations of this game include power-ups designed to assist players in their quest for a high score. These enhancements can provide temporary advantages, making obstacle avoidance easier and rabbit collection more efficient. Common power-ups might include a shield that protects against a single collision, a magnet that automatically attracts nearby rabbits, or a speed boost that allows for faster movement. Strategic use of power-ups is critical; saving them for particularly challenging sections of the road or using them to capitalize on opportunities for mass rabbit collection can dramatically impact your overall score. Experimenting with different power-up combinations allows players to discover synergistic effects, further optimizing their gameplay.
Maximizing Power-Up Effectiveness with Timing
The effectiveness of power-ups isn't solely dependent on their intrinsic abilities; timing is equally important. Activating a shield just before encountering a series of obstacles can prevent a game-ending collision, while deploying a magnet during a heavy rabbit cluster maximizes collection efficiency. A speed boost is most useful on long, straight stretches of the road, allowing players to cover significant distance quickly. Learning to recognize the optimal moments for each power-up requires practice and observation. Paying attention to the upcoming road conditions and anticipating challenges will help you make the most of these valuable enhancements.
- Prioritize shield usage for sections with dense obstacle patterns.
- Deploy the magnet when multiple rabbits are clustered together.
- Use the speed boost on straightaways to maximize distance covered.
- Save power-ups for moments of high risk or opportunity.
Efficient power-up management is a hallmark of skilled players. Understanding the strengths and weaknesses of each enhancement, combined with precise timing, can elevate your gameplay to new heights.
